Job Summary: The IT Procurement Coordinator will be primarily responsible for the management, budgeting, and documentation of the Assets for Optimized IT and all Optimized IT's clients. This role will also involve collaboration work with members of Optimized IT's Sales, Service and Administrative teams.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

Asset Management:

Assistwith purchasing and managing IT assets. Responsible for product support and warranties, renewals, maintenance, and software contracts, as well as hardware purchases, and license information. Maintain vendor contract data. Receiving and tagging equipment. Entering asset information into asset tracking software system. Obtain and review competitive bids, quotes, and proposals from vendors and contractors; discuss evaluations and review with requesters and subject matter experts. Maintain product catalog cost and pricing. Provide pricing quotes for items and preparing,orders with suppliers. Responsible for shipping defective equipment to vendorand arranging replacement. Research products and equipment; prepare product/equipment specifications. Research websites/contact vendors to gather technical information and prices on supplies and equipment Works with ITTeam tomaintainrepositoryof enterprise software licenses/keys. Help coordinate purchases for team when service-related needs arise Asset Budget / Documentation:

Establish andmaintainvendor relationships. Negotiate with vendors for the best price over contracted services and purchases, as well as future purchases. Coordinate with selected vendors on supply and delivery of purchased items. EOL-End of life management Responsible for all surplus inventories including recording all End of Life (EOL) inventories and disposal. Responsible for decommissioning assets and oversee surplus removal as needed (Ewaste) COMPETENCIES

Experience with software licensing and volumepurchasingagreements for the major enterprise system software suppliers (e.g., SonicWALL, HP, Microsoft...) Experience in presenting technology recommendations from a business perspective. Experience in planning and carrying out software license audits & reconcilements.
